Dating Confidence Reset: Practical Steps To Feel Grounded

If you feel tired of slow replies, dead-end conversations, or being overlooked, start with small, practical choices that restore control and calm. Clarity about what you want and how much time you’ll spend on dating keeps frustration from building.

Clarify Your Intent

Write down one or two realistic goals for your Mingle2 use this week — for example, “have three genuine conversations” or “set one low-pressure video call.” Keep goals concrete and short-term so you can notice progress.

Set Healthy Pace And Boundaries

  • Limit daily app time to prevent exhaustion — 15–30 minutes of focused activity is more effective than endless swiping.
  • Decide when you’ll move a conversation off the app (text, phone, or video) and what pace feels comfortable for you.
  • Use messages to assess fit: ask a couple of clear, light questions that reveal values or lifestyle rather than running an interview.

Keep Expectations Realistic

Expect some mismatches and slow replies. That’s normal. Instead of measuring success by “matches” or replies, measure it by whether conversations reveal enough about someone’s habits, kindness, and compatibility to decide on a next step.

Notice Progress, Not Perfection

  • Celebrate small wins: a message that made you laugh, a thoughtful reply, or a plan that moved from chat to a call.
  • Track patterns: what opening lines get responses, which profiles match your priorities, and what times of day work best for replies.

Choose Matches Thoughtfully

Scan profiles for concrete signals that matter to you (interests, availability, communication style) and prioritize quality over quantity. It’s fine to unmatch or step back from conversations that consistently leave you feeling drained.

Maintain Emotional Steadiness

When a message disappoints, pause before reacting. Take a short break, do something that recharges you, and return with curiosity rather than urgency. Remind yourself that dating is a selection process, not a reflection of your worth.
